Officine Panerai is an Italian luxury watchmaker combining Florentine design heritage with Swiss horological manufacture; the brand operates within the Richemont Group and is recognized for its precision mechanical timepieces and artisanal ateliers. - Diagnose, service and repair haute horlogerie mechanical movements and complications to Panerai quality standards.
- Assemble, regulate and adjust escapements, chronograph mechanisms, tourbillons and other high-complication components with micrometric precision.
- Execute finishing operations and dimensional controls according to technical dossiers and quality control procedures.
- Perform timing, water-resistance and endurance testing using industry-standard equipment; record results and corrective actions in service documentation.
- Collaborate with R&D and Quality departments to report recurrent failures, suggest technical improvements and implement corrective measures.
- Maintain and calibrate specialised tools and bench equipment; ensure compliance with workplace safety and cleanliness protocols.
- Swiss Watchmaking Diploma (CFC) or WOSTEP certification, or equivalent formal horological qualification.
- Proven competence with haute horlogerie complications (e.g., chronograph, GMT, perpetual calendar, tourbillon).
- Exceptional manual dexterity, visual acuity and experience under a microscope for micro-assembly tasks.
- Fluent understanding of technical dossiers, service procedures and quality documentation.
